As a college student I have grown sick and tired of

rising tution rates, paying exhorbitant textbook prices and not receiving fair representation, or even a chance be heard on our campuses. The Arizona constitution even states:

Section 6. The university and all other state educational institutions shall be open to students of both sexes, and the instruction furnished shall be as nearly free as possible. The legislature shall provide for a system of common schools by which a free school shall be established and maintained in every school district for at least six months in each year, which school shall be open to all pupils between the ages of six and twenty-one years.
